Output 1ee176051ba4af76e73eb0ea300bd15f521cd34c8d96eda5392e3d123b061404:3

value
8915286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2eb18aab9041a2c695a3db6fb2bebaf96b3dee8 OP_EQUAL
address
3KTeeYGiJVorTj4BJAp9VFnydikqEun4Wj
transaction
1ee176051ba4af76e73eb0ea300bd15f521cd34c8d96eda5392e3d123b061404
spent
true